In addition to the previously announced album from Ghost & Writer, the new Fracture album and the single from KMFDM, early 2011 will also see the release of two new compilations: first, a new installment of the limited edition Dependent label compilation „Dependence 2011“, featuring brand new and unreleased material from Dependent artists, and a second compilation „Dependent Club Anthems“ which, as the name suggests, will contain the biggest clubhits by Dependent bands such as Suicide Commando, Rotersand, Covenant, Seabound, Pride And Fall, etc. etc. Finally, look for a new Dismantled album and a digital single from Veil Veil Vanish.

Helloween, Stratovarius
HELLOWEEN’s history started way back in 1984. The band made their breakthrough with the release of ‘Keeper Of The Seven Keys Pt.1’ in 1987 that sold incredibly back in the day. Part 2 of the series went on to become even more successful than its predecessor. But a career never is defined by happy times only and a crisis broke upon HELLOWEEN as well at some point. Some bands are broken by that; others rise from the ashes again and HELLOWEEN managed to do the latter; started anew and got as successful as ever before. 2010 has seen them returning with a new album ‘7 Sinners’, in support of which they’re going to tour Germany and also stop in Oberhausen & Osnabrück. In tow of them will be Finnish Power Metal outfit STRATOVARIUS as a proper support.

Chameleons Vox, Luxury Stranger
History starts with THE CHAMELEONS getting formed in 1981. They’re standing in line with bands such as JOY DIVISION or ECHO & THE BUNNYMEN, however never even getting close to the mentioned band’s successes. Nevertheless, their first album ‘Script Of The Bridge’ is considered one of the most important records in Post-Punk today, and also the following little list of albums found not a little list of appreciators today. Due to death of manager and friend Tony Fletcher, the band disbanded in 1987. A reunion took place but never reached the class of early times again.
